What you will do

  • Generate revenue by structured counseling sessions to prospects and converting them to paid enrollment and advise students/parents for their learning needs.
  • Diligently communicating and educating the leads through channels like email, WhatsApp, SMS, and calls.
  • Take a prospect from initial phase to qualified phase over the phone product solutions virtually.
  • Regular follow up with new and existing customers.
  • Monitoring self-performance at all times while also contributing to the team performance.

Requirements

  • 0 to 1 years of Direct Sales experience (B2C/B2B)
  • Account Management experience common with using CRM
  • Good knowledge of Microsoft Office and Google Tools
  • Candidates should be graduated
  • English language proficiency is mandatory
